Is my husbands company pension reported on a T4A in Box 16 eligible for pension splitting with me if we are under 65?

we are under 65 and are we eligible for pension splitting?

Yes, individuals under age 65 are eligible for pension splitting if they receive lifetime annuity payments from a registered pension plan (RPP).These payments are reported in Box 16 of the T4A slip and transfer to Line 115 of the tax return which qualifies them as "eligible pension income" for pension splitting.

NoteRRIF income cannot be split under age 65.
